John Christian Talma

Affiliations

  • Chief Financial Officer at Chase Corp (CCF), 2021-02-05
Insider Trading: Sales See All
Company Symbol Price Amount Relationship Remaining Holdings Date Form 4
CCF $108.75 340 Officer 5,428 2020-07-29 Filing